A Dream Against The Odds

In the high-stakes realm of soccer, audacious aspirations usually get greeted with suspicion, if not outright ridicule. This was precisely what befell Pitso Mosimane, the former Bafana Bafana coach, when he publicly declared his bold ambition of emerging as Africa’s finest coach. The executives of South Africa Football Association (SAFA), along with the Mzansi media, expressed their scepticism and criticism, but Mosimane remained undaunted. He drew strength from the successful track records of globally acclaimed managers such as Jurgen Klopp of Liverpool FC and Carlo Ancelotti of Real Madrid.

Mosimane, reflecting on his illustrious career, revisited his tenure with Mamelodi Sundowns, SuperSport United, and Al Ahly. He credited these experiences for shaping his distinctive coaching philosophy. His strategy, heavily influenced by his respect for Klopp’s teams’ knack for initiating play from the back, has been a driving force in his career.

A Victorious Journey

At Chloorkop, Mosimane’s first full season was groundbreaking. With a formidable record of eight terms, he won the PSL title and secured 11 remarkable trophies. Reflecting on this transformative journey, Mosimane recalled, “The first six months were dedicated to evaluating the squad. I radically overhauled the team and brought in players with the right mindset. The league title came home in my inaugural year.”

Mosimane advocates a coaching style that emphasizes ball possession and aggressive recovery when possession is lost. His philosophy mirrors that of his favourite clubs – Manchester City, Brighton, and Arsenal, as well as Carlo Ancelotti’s tactical approach at Real Madrid. He also holds Jurgen Klopp’s counter-pressing style in high esteem. Expressing his perspective, he noted, “I appreciate teams that maintain principled stands when it comes to defence. So, I incorporate all those beneficial aspects together.”

Learning From The Best And Overcoming Challenges

Throughout his career, Mosimane has been a diligent student of soccer, garnering valuable insights from his stint with the legendary Brazilian coach, Carlos Alberto Parreira, during the 2010 FIFA World Cup. He reminisced, “I was like a sponge — absorbing everything that Parreira did. I learned so much from him about movement, tactics and team organization.”

However, his journey has not been devoid of challenges. His tenure at Bafana Bafana was fraught with hurdles. An executive from SAFA even suggested that he refrain from participating in significant matches to avoid the mounting pressure, while the Mzansi media continued their critique.

But Mosimane refused to succumb. He persevered through the setback, saying, “I had aspirations to transform the team, but they let me go. I pleaded, ‘Please don’t dismiss me, I have more to offer’. I was emotional and declared, ‘I’m going to emerge as one of the best coaches on the continent — watch this space’.”

Despite the severe media backlash, Mosimane remained undeterred. Today, he is recognized as one of Africa’s most esteemed and successful coaches, having proven his critics wrong. His legacy is an ode to his perseverance, adaptability, and unwavering confidence in his coaching skills.
